Determined Bojan Miovski reckons Rangers will have to maintain their Rugby Park standards if they want to force themselves back into the title ruckus.
The Ibrox ace broke an 11-game drought as his killer double shot down Killie on Saturday night .
The 3-0 win moved Danny Rohl’s team to within six points of leaders Celtic and Hearts ahead of today’s top-of-the-table Parkhead shootout.
But Miovski reckons the only way Gers will get any closer is if they carry on where they left off in Ayrshire.
He said: "If you win one game, you are for the title race, you lose one game, you are not.
"There's still a lot of gamest go, to be honest. And of course, we want to be there, but we need to be consistent to collect points.
